An X icon on Snapchat means that the person has unfriended you or you haven’t accepted their friend request yet. Your messages and Snaps won’t go through until they’ve added you back or you’ve accepted their friend request. To get rid of the X icon, you can either add them as a friend or block their account.Snapchat Icons | What does each one mean: • Sent Icons: Red arrow: A Snap sent without audio. Purple arrow: A Snap sent with audio. Blue arrow: A sent Chat. Red emptied arrow: Receiver opened a Snap without audio. Purple emptied arrow: Receiver opened a Snap with audio. The ‘X’ on Snapchat is a symbol that appears next to a friend’s name on the app. It indicates that you and that friend are no longer connected on the app, and you will not be able to send each other snaps, messages, or view each other’s stories. However, you can remove the ‘X’ by adding them as a friend again or asking ...

The pulsating effect is just a visual indication that the …On Snapchat, the X means that person is not on your friends list. If you were friends on Snapchat with this person before, it likely means that they unfriended you. But if you haven’t ever had this person on your friends list, the X means that they’ve sent you a request that you haven’t accepted yet. [1] Why is ‘delivered’ flashing on Snapchat? The word ‘delivered’ flashes after you send a message to let you know that it has delivered to the friend successfully. “When the word ‘delivered’ is flashing on Snapchat, it means that the Snap you sent has been successfully delivered to the recipient,” Snapchat’s chatbot My AI confirmed.

If a user sees a fire emoji next to a friend's name, it means they are on a Snapstreak together. This is when the user and their friend have Snapped — sent a photo or a video back and forth between each other — once a day for at least three days in a row. Snap said today that its Snapchat+ paid plan has more... publix palatka The hourglass symbol on Snapchat is a countdown timer that appears when you and a friend have an ongoing streak. The hourglass signifies that you need to send a snap to your friend to maintain the streak before the timer runs out. The hourglass emoji appears next to your friend’s name when the streak is about to expire. Takeaways>.If a Snap is left on ‘delivered,’ it means that the recipient has not yet opened the Snap.
